Car Insurance Online vs Offline: How to Pick the Best Way to Buy?

Whether you get it online or offline, getting a car insurance is most important

Published On Dec 31, 2025 10:23 AM By CarDekho
5255 Views

After buying a new car, it's important to protect it from any sort of unprecedented damage, accidents, theft, or third-party liability. For such scenarios, car insurance is essential. Today, buyers generally have two options. They can either buy car insurance online or choose the offline method through a local branch or insurance agent. Both methods have their own advantages, depending on convenience, comfort, and the level of information required.

After comparing both online and offline options, this report helps you choose the right one so that your insurance purchase and claim process remains simple and sensible.

Advantages of Buying Car Insurance Online

You can now buy car insurance online and choose the most suitable plan for your car.

Here are the key benefits of opting for online car insurance:

  • No need to visit a branch: You can buy car insurance from the comfort of your home. There is no need to visit a branch, stand in long queues, or meet an agent. You can complete the process at your convenience.

  • Compare multiple plans easily: Online platforms allow you to view multiple insurance plans in one place. You can check policies from different companies, compare them, and then select the right one.

  • Instant premium calculation: With an online premium calculator, you can instantly know how much premium you need to pay. This gives you a clear idea of the cost beforehand.

  • Faster process: Since everything is done online, the policy purchase and renewal process is completed quickly. This saves a lot of time.

  • Lower cost: Online car insurance does not involve intermediaries. You make payments directly to the company, which usually results in a lower premium.

  • Complete information available on the website: Insurance company websites clearly display policy details, benefits, terms, and conditions. You can read everything carefully before making a final decision.

  • Check reviews and claim settlement ratio: A company’s claim settlement ratio is very important while filing claims. It shows how efficiently the company settles claims. Always check reviews, ratings, and ratios before purchasing.

  • 24-hour assistance: If you have any questions or face issues, you can seek help via email, call, or chat. Companies provide round-the-clock online customer support.

Advantages of Buying Car Insurance Offline

Although the online process is quick and easy, many people still prefer buying car insurance offline through an agent.

Here are some of its pros:

  • Face-to-face assistance from an agent: Even in today’s digital age, many people, especially senior citizens and first-time buyers, prefer discussing policies in person. An agent explains coverage and benefits clearly.

  • Suitable for people with limited digital knowledge: Not everyone is comfortable with online forms or digital payments. For such individuals, the offline method is simpler.

  • Easy understanding of complex terms: Policy terms can sometimes be difficult to understand. Speaking directly to an agent helps simplify technical language and conditions.

  • Help with paperwork: Its common to make mistakes in filling forms incorrectly. And in this case, the agents assist with documentation and also support during the claim process, making everything easier.

  • Ideal for first-time buyers: Trust is an important factor for first-time car buyers, especially the elderly generation of customers. In this case, face-to-face interaction with an agent helps build confidence.

  • Immediate assistance: The sales executives can provide quick help whenever needed, whether for documentation, claims, or guidance during difficult situations.

Difference Between Online and Offline Car Insurance

Buyers often get confused while choosing between online and offline car insurance, as both offer protection and savings. Here’s a simple comparison that helps in making the right decision.

Point

Online Car Insurance

Offline Car Insurance

Purchase process

Fully digital and paperless

Manual paperwork and signatures

Comparison options

Easy comparison of multiple insurers in one place

Limited to options suggested by the agent

Premium cost

Usually lower as there is no agent commission

Slightly higher due to agent fees

Convenience

Can be purchased anytime from anywhere

Requires visiting a branch or meeting an agent

Transparency

Policy details, benefits and terms are clearly visible online

Depends on how well the agent explains the policy

Processing time

Fast purchase and renewal process

Takes more time due to manual steps

Payment options

Multiple online payment methods available

Cash, cheque or offline payment modes

Claim assistance

Online tracking and customer support

Personal assistance from an agent

The Correct Way Of Choosing A Car Insurance

There is no single best option when it comes to choosing car insurance. The right choice depends on how comfortable you are with the process, how quickly you need the policy, and whether you prefer handling things on your own or with help.

  1. Easy Comparison And Full Control

If you want to compare several plans available in the market and save money on premiums, online car insurance is the right option. It saves time and online platforms allow easy comparison of third-party and comprehensive car insurance plans.

  1. Face-To-Face Assistance

If you need help understanding policy language, inclusions, and exclusions, buying car insurance offline through an agent is more suitable. They also help with documentation, survey coordination, and answering queries.

  1. Digital Comfort Matters

If you can handle online payments and digital forms, online car insurance works best. If you prefer personal interaction or are buying insurance for the first time, the offline option may feel safer and more comfortable.

  1. Focus On Your Budget

Before you decide, it is important to review your budget carefully. While online car insurance is usually cheaper because it eliminates third-party commissions. This is why many buyers choose it for lower costs and faster processing.

CarDekho Says…

While choosing between online and offline car insurance, what matters most is a buyer’s trust, convenience and expectations. Online purchases offer lower costs, faster processes, and convenience, while offline insurance provides personal assistance and trust. Both methods ultimately protect your vehicle and finances during accidents. You need to understand your needs, compare plans carefully first, and then choose the right car insurance without stress.
